摘要: 目录 java内存区域和内存溢出异常 虚拟机运行时数据区 线程私有 程序计数器 虚拟机栈 本地方法栈 公共部分 堆 方法区 运行时常量池 直接内存 参考文章 对象的创建 对象的内存布局 对象的访问定位 实战:OOM异常 java堆溢出 虚拟机栈和本地方法栈溢出 虚拟机运行时数据区 线程私有 程序计数 阅读全文
posted @ 2018-09-27 18:06 walkerluo 阅读(155) 评论(0) 推荐(0) 编辑
摘要: 原理 临近的数字两两进行比较,按照从小到大(或者从大到小)的顺序进行交换, 这样一趟过去后,最大(或最小)的数字被交换到了最后一位, 然后再从头开始进行两两比较交换,直到倒数第二位时结束,其余类似看例子。 算法的关键是,循环几趟,每趟比较几次 例子 从小到大排序 原始待排序数组| 7 | 3 | 2 阅读全文
posted @ 2018-09-27 17:29 walkerluo 阅读(110) 评论(0) 推荐(0) 编辑